1. Enhanced Building Protection
Weather Resistance
Industrial cladding contractors use materials specifically designed to withstand harsh weather conditions. Cladding provides an extra layer of protection against rain, wind, and UV radiation, preventing structural damage and reducing maintenance costs over time.
Thermal Insulation
One of the significant benefits of industrial cladding is its ability to improve a building’s thermal insulation. Cladding helps in maintaining a consistent internal temperature, reducing the reliance on heating and cooling systems, and ultimately lowering energy bills. This is particularly crucial in industrial settings where temperature control is vital for operations.

6. Safety and Compliance
Fire Resistance
Many cladding materials used by industrial cladding contractors are designed to be fire-resistant. This added layer of protection is crucial in industrial settings where fire hazards may be present. Cladding helps in containing fires and preventing them from spreading, thus enhancing overall building safety.

8. Improved Acoustic Performance
Noise Reduction
Cladding can also improve the acoustic performance of a building by reducing noise transmission. This is particularly beneficial in industrial settings where machinery and operations generate significant noise. Improved acoustic insulation enhances the working environment, contributing to better productivity and employee satisfaction.
